Syrian security forces take aim from a rooftop position amid ongoing clashes in the southern city of Sweida, on July 16, 2025. Damascus deployed troops in the predominantly Druze province after clashes between Druze fighters and Bedouin tribes killed scores of people, with Syria's defense minister declaring a cease-fire on July 15 in Sweida city, which government forces entered in the morning.
